(a)
(1) has a skill in which the Navy has a critical shortage of personnel (as determined by the Secretary of the Navy); and
(2) is serving in a position (as determined by the Secretary of the Navy) which (A) is designated to be held by a lieutenant commander, and (B) requires that an officer serving in such position have the skill possessed by such officer,
may be temporarily promoted to the grade of lieutenant commander under regulations to be prescribed by the Secretary of the Navy. Appointments under this section shall be made by the President, by and with the advice and consent of the Senate.

AMENDMENTS2002—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 107–314 struck out par. (1) designation and struck out par. (2) which read as follows: "Whenever the Secretary makes a change to the positions designated under paragraph (1), the Secretary shall submit notice of the change in writing to Congress."
1996—Subsec. (a). Pub. L. 104–201, §503(a), (c), substituted "Officers" for "Officer" in heading and "the President, by and with the advice and consent of the Senate" for "the President alone" in concluding provisions.
Pub. L. 104–106, §508(d)(1), inserted heading.
Subsecs. (b) to (e). Pub. L. 104–106, §508(d)(2)–(5), inserted headings.
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 104–106, §508(b)(2), added subsec. (f). Former subsec. (f) redesignated (g).
Pub. L. 104–106, §508(a), substituted "September 30, 1996" for "September 30, 1995".
Subsec. (g). Pub. L. 104–201, §503(b), struck out subsec. (g) which read as follows: "
Pub. L. 104–106, §508(d)(6), inserted heading.
Pub. L. 104–106, §508(b)(1), redesignated subsec. (f) as (g).
1993—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 103–160 substituted "September 30, 1995" for "September 30, 1993".
1992—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 102–484 substituted "September 30, 1993" for "September 30, 1992".
1989—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 101–189 substituted "September 30, 1992" for "September 30, 1989".
1987—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 100–180 substituted "September 30, 1989" for "September 30, 1987".
1986—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 99–661 substituted "September 30, 1987" for "September 30, 1986".
1984—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 98–525 substituted "September 30, 1986" for "September 30, 1984".
1983—Subsec. (f). Pub. L. 98–94 substituted "September 30, 1984" for "September 30, 1983".

SAVINGS PROVISIONPub. L. 101–189, div. A, title V, §512(b), Nov. 29, 1989, 103 Stat. 1439, provided that:
"(1) The Secretary of the Navy shall provide, in the case of an officer appointed to the grade of lieutenant commander on or after the date of the enactment of this Act [Nov. 29, 1989] under an appointment described in paragraph (2), that the date of rank of such officer under that appointment shall be the date of rank that would have applied to the appointment had the authority referred to in that paragraph not lapsed.
"(2) An appointment referred to in paragraph (1) is an appointment under 5721 of title 10, United States Code, that (as determined by the Secretary of the Navy) would have been made during the period beginning on October 1, 1989, and ending on the date of the enactment of this Act had the authority to make appointments under that section not lapsed during such period."
